This year’s Colombia field trip explored uncharted territory. Mercanta are very excited to have finally gained access to Nariño province in Colombia’s far south-west, out of bounds until recently due to security concerns. The Nordic Barista Cup: The first competition took place in Denmark in 2003 and it’s been going from strength to strength every year since. These annual events bring together baristas and many other specialty coffee professionals in an environment where knowledge can be shared through meeting, learning, seminars…and a lot of very hands-on practical workshops
